Locarno - Domodossola or vv is a pleasant day trip. A US passport card should suffice.
Iirc the first time I made that trip was via a very local train in 1954.
I was using a Saver Day Pass (49SFR) and for my "
day trip" did ZRH-LOCARNO (new Gotthard Tunnel)-Domodossola-Brig (Simplon Tunnel)-Zermat-Visp-Zurich ("new" Visp Tunnel)
...So I did 3 of their MAJOR tunnels in one day.
The first time I used the Cent. line (shortly before EU began), going from Locarno to Dom. Italian PP agents did a PP check at the Swiss -Italy border; now at the border a vendor boards with a food cart for selling snacks/drinks.
